Indian monsoon death toll rises
Health workers and volunteers today distributed food, medicines and drinking water in south-eastern India where monsoon rains have killed 74 people over the last three days.
Flood waters were receding in many parts of Andhra Pradesh state, but more than 122,000 people were still in relief camps after torrential rains and a cyclone in the Bay of Bengal hit India’s south-eastern coast flooding thousands of villages and towns.
